    FLAX BREAD

    mix ground flax (1/4 cup) with 1 tablespoon of olive oil or butter. Beat in 1 egg. Add 1 tsp of baking powder. Put IT in a bowl that is the shape you want the bread (like round for a bun, for example). Microwave for 1 minute. Immediately turn it over and out of the bowl you cooked it in. In a few minutes it will dry. You can cut in half and you have 2 good size pieces of bread for adding anything, cheese, butter, ham, philadelphia, etc

    blogilates banana pancake. Real easy to do and tastes great. Mix two whole eggs with 1 banana (chopped and mashed or blended) and then cook on a griddle plate, in a fry pan etc (use spray oil or other low cal options) Takes a couple of mins and tastes like full on pancakes. Yes there is carbs in there in the form of banana but it is good carbs for energy and of course protein from the eggs.

    Make mini souffles! Grease muffin tins really well, brown sausage, bacon, onions, whatever and divide into each tin. Beat some eggs with heavy whipping cream, beat in seasonings, and pour over each filling. Bake at 350 until done, and you have a super filling breakfast!

    Sometimes I will make an egg cream because eating eggs does get old. My recipe is simple and basic:

    - 2 or 3 eggs
    - 1 cup unsweetened almond milk
    - 2tbsp HWC
    - stevia to taste
    - ice
    - 1 tbsp flax oil
    - blend until smooth

    You can't even tell the egg is in there. What's perfect about egg cream's is that they are fast, so if you have a travel blender, you just put everything in and go. Sometimes I'll add protein in. A little bit of chocolate protein makes this taste like chocolate milk. I'll also make a "pumpkin latte" with the basic recipe. Just add in 1/4 cup warm pureed pumpkin, and I use the Dunkin Donuts Pumpkin Spice coffee. Add a shot of expresso if you have it for more of a strong coffee, add some stevia, eggs and HWC and it's good to go!
